Company Profile
Jackmont Hospitality is a minority-owned, comprehensive hospitality company head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ia. The firm's core mission is to redefine airport hospitality and restaurant management. They operate as a foodservice management company, owning and managing a portfolio of restaurants, including TGI Fridays® franchises, and providing on-site foodservice solutions for various clients. These clients span corporations, educational institutions, and healthcare facilities across the United States. While primarily an operating company, Jackmont Hospitality also engages in strategic acquisitions of hospitality assets.
The spirit of Jackmont Hospitality originated from the 1930s family resort of the late Maynard H. Jackson, Sr., and Dr. Irene Dobbs Jackson, known as “Jackson's Mountain.” This retreat offered good food and warm hospitality during a segregated era. Years later, in 1994, Maynard H. Jackson, Jr. (son of the founders), Brooke Jackson Edmond (daughter), and Daniel Halpern co-founded Jackmont Hospitality. The company was named in honor of the Jackson family's history, aiming to combine traditional hospitality with modern business solutions.
Jackmont Hospitality's portfolio primarily consists of the restaurants and foodservice operations it owns and manages. A notable investment activity includes a corporate asset purchase in 2015, where the firm acquired 16 TGI Friday's restaurants located in Miami and Fort Lauderdale. The company has also successfully raised significant funding, with PitchBook reporting $112 million in total funding across five financing rounds, with Brightwood Capital Advisors listed as an investor in Jackmont Hospitality.
The team at Jackmont Hospitality is described as a diverse group of industry experts, fostering an environment that emphasizes professionalism, work-life balance, and a strong sense of family. The firm is committed to investing in its employees, promoting growth from within, and selecting talent for the right opportunities. Key principals include Daniel Halpern, who serves as CEO and Co-founder, Brooke Jackson Edmond, Executive Vice President and Co-founder, and Valerie Richardson Jackson, Chairman of the Board and Principal.
